The theoretical weight of aluminum alloy profiles
The theoretical weight of aluminum alloy profiles is mainly determined by its density and volume, simply speaking, the theoretical weight of aluminum alloy profiles = density * volume. In fact, the theoretical weight of aluminum alloy profiles is calculated by the weight per meter, that is, the unit of theoretical weight is kg/m.
To calculate the theoretical weight of the aluminum alloy profile, we must first determine the cross-sectional area of the aluminum alloy profile, and the cross-sectional area of different styles of aluminum alloy profiles is different.
The common styles are right-angle profiles, straight T-profiles, grooved profiles, Z-shaped profiles, I-shaped profiles, etc.; Then to determine the density of aluminum alloy, there are also many densities of aluminum alloys, commonly used aluminum alloy density between 2680-2830; Finally, the theoretical weight of the aluminum alloy profile can be determined, and the theoretical weight = cross-sectional area * density * 1 meter.
